def http_user_agent(user_agent: Union[Dict, str, None] = None) -> str:
|
|
"""
|
|
Formats a user-agent string with basic info about a request.
|
|
"""
|
|
ua = f"diffusers/{__version__}; python/{sys.version.split()[0]}; session_id/{SESSION_ID}"
|
|
if HF_HUB_DISABLE_TELEMETRY or HF_HUB_OFFLINE:
|
|
return ua + "; telemetry/off"
|
|
if is_torch_available():
|
|
ua += f"; torch/{_torch_version}"
|
|
if is_flax_available():
|
|
ua += f"; jax/{_jax_version}"
|
|
ua += f"; flax/{_flax_version}"
|
|
if is_onnx_available():
|
|
ua += f"; onnxruntime/{_onnxruntime_version}"
|
|
# CI will set this value to True
|
|
if os.environ.get("DIFFUSERS_IS_CI", "").upper() in ENV_VARS_TRUE_VALUES:
|
|
ua += "; is_ci/true"
|
|
if isinstance(user_agent, dict):
|
|
ua += "; " + "; ".join(f"{k}/{v}" for k, v in user_agent.items())
|
|
elif isinstance(user_agent, str):
|
|
ua += "; " + user_agent
|
|
return ua

def load_or_create_model_card(
|
|
repo_id_or_path: str = None,
|
|
token: Optional[str] = None,
|
|
is_pipeline: bool = False,
|
|
from_training: bool = False,
|
|
model_description: Optional[str] = None,
|
|
base_model: str = None,
|
|
prompt: Optional[str] = None,
|
|
license: Optional[str] = None,
|
|
widget: Optional[List[dict]] = None,
|
|
inference: Optional[bool] = None,
|
|
) -> ModelCard:
|
|
"""
|
|
Loads or creates a model card.
|
|
|
|
Args:
|
|
repo_id_or_path (`str`):
|
|
The repo id (e.g., "runwayml/stable-diffusion-v1-5") or local path where to look for the model card.
|
|
token (`str`, *optional*):
|
|
Authentication token. Will default to the stored token. See https://huggingface.co/settings/token for more
|
|
details.
|
|
is_pipeline (`bool`):
|
|
Boolean to indicate if we're adding tag to a [`DiffusionPipeline`].
|
|
from_training: (`bool`): Boolean flag to denote if the model card is being created from a training script.
|
|
model_description (`str`, *optional*): Model description to add to the model card. Helpful when using
|
|
`load_or_create_model_card` from a training script.
|
|
base_model (`str`): Base model identifier (e.g., "stabilityai/stable-diffusion-xl-base-1.0"). Useful
|
|
for DreamBooth-like training.
|
|
prompt (`str`, *optional*): Prompt used for training. Useful for DreamBooth-like training.
|
|
license: (`str`, *optional*): License of the output artifact. Helpful when using
|
|
`load_or_create_model_card` from a training script.
|
|
widget (`List[dict]`, *optional*): Widget to accompany a gallery template.
|
|
inference: (`bool`, optional): Whether to turn on inference widget. Helpful when using
|
|
`load_or_create_model_card` from a training script.
|
|
"""
|
|
if not is_jinja_available():
|
|
raise ValueError(
|
|
"Modelcard rendering is based on Jinja templates."
|
|
" Please make sure to have `jinja` installed before using `load_or_create_model_card`."
|
|
" To install it, please run `pip install Jinja2`."
|
|
)
|
|
|
|
try:
|
|
# Check if the model card is present on the remote repo
|
|
model_card = ModelCard.load(repo_id_or_path, token=token)
|
|
except (EntryNotFoundError, RepositoryNotFoundError):
|
|
# Otherwise create a model card from template
|
|
if from_training:
|
|
model_card = ModelCard.from_template(
|
|
card_data=ModelCardData( # Card metadata object that will be converted to YAML block
|
|
license=license,
|
|
library_name="diffusers",
|
|
inference=inference,
|
|
base_model=base_model,
|
|
instance_prompt=prompt,
|
|
widget=widget,
|
|
),
|
|
template_path=MODEL_CARD_TEMPLATE_PATH,
|
|
model_description=model_description,
|
|
)
|
|
else:
|
|
card_data = ModelCardData()
|
|
component = "pipeline" if is_pipeline else "model"
|
|
if model_description is None:
|
|
model_description = f"This is the model card of a 🧨 diffusers {component} that has been pushed on the Hub. This model card has been automatically generated."
|
|
model_card = ModelCard.from_template(card_data, model_description=model_description)
|
|
|
|
return model_card

class PushToHubMixin:
|
|
"""
|
|
A Mixin to push a model, scheduler, or pipeline to the Hugging Face Hub.
|
|
"""
|
|
|
|
def _upload_folder(
|
|
self,
|
|
working_dir: Union[str, os.PathLike],
|
|
repo_id: str,
|
|
token: Optional[str] = None,
|
|
commit_message: Optional[str] = None,
|
|
create_pr: bool = False,
|
|
):
|
|
"""
|
|
Uploads all files in `working_dir` to `repo_id`.
|
|
"""
|
|
if commit_message is None:
|
|
if "Model" in self.__class__.__name__:
|
|
commit_message = "Upload model"
|
|
elif "Scheduler" in self.__class__.__name__:
|
|
commit_message = "Upload scheduler"
|
|
else:
|
|
commit_message = f"Upload {self.__class__.__name__}"
|
|
|
|
logger.info(f"Uploading the files of {working_dir} to {repo_id}.")
|
|
return upload_folder(
|
|
repo_id=repo_id, folder_path=working_dir, token=token, commit_message=commit_message, create_pr=create_pr
|
|
)
|
|
|
|
def push_to_hub(
|
|
self,
|
|
repo_id: str,
|
|
commit_message: Optional[str] = None,
|
|
private: Optional[bool] = None,
|
|
token: Optional[str] = None,
|
|
create_pr: bool = False,
|
|
safe_serialization: bool = True,
|
|
variant: Optional[str] = None,
|
|
) -> str:
|
|
"""
|
|
Upload model, scheduler, or pipeline files to the 🤗 Hugging Face Hub.
|
|
|
|
Parameters:
|
|
repo_id (`str`):
|
|
The name of the repository you want to push your model, scheduler, or pipeline files to. It should
|
|
contain your organization name when pushing to an organization. `repo_id` can also be a path to a local
|
|
directory.
|
|
commit_message (`str`, *optional*):
|
|
Message to commit while pushing. Default to `"Upload {object}"`.
|
|
private (`bool`, *optional*):
|
|
Whether to make the repo private. If `None` (default), the repo will be public unless the
|
|
organization's default is private. This value is ignored if the repo already exists.
|
|
token (`str`, *optional*):
|
|
The token to use as HTTP bearer authorization for remote files. The token generated when running
|
|
`huggingface-cli login` (stored in `~/.huggingface`).
|
|
create_pr (`bool`, *optional*, defaults to `False`):
|
|
Whether or not to create a PR with the uploaded files or directly commit.
|
|
safe_serialization (`bool`, *optional*, defaults to `True`):
|
|
Whether or not to convert the model weights to the `safetensors` format.
|
|
variant (`str`, *optional*):
|
|
If specified, weights are saved in the format `pytorch_model.<variant>.bin`.
|
|
|
|
Examples:
|
|
|
|
```python
|
|
from diffusers import UNet2DConditionModel
|
|
|
|
unet = UNet2DConditionModel.from_pretrained("stabilityai/stable-diffusion-2", subfolder="unet")
|
|
|
|
# Push the `unet` to your namespace with the name "my-finetuned-unet".
|
|
unet.push_to_hub("my-finetuned-unet")
|
|
|
|
# Push the `unet` to an organization with the name "my-finetuned-unet".
|
|
unet.push_to_hub("your-org/my-finetuned-unet")
|
|
```
|
|
"""
|
|
repo_id = create_repo(repo_id, private=private, token=token, exist_ok=True).repo_id
|
|
|
|
# Create a new empty model card and eventually tag it
|
|
model_card = load_or_create_model_card(repo_id, token=token)
|
|
model_card = populate_model_card(model_card)
|
|
|
|
# Save all files.
|
|
save_kwargs = {"safe_serialization": safe_serialization}
|
|
if "Scheduler" not in self.__class__.__name__:
|
|
save_kwargs.update({"variant": variant})
|
|
|
|
with tempfile.TemporaryDirectory() as tmpdir:
|
|
self.save_pretrained(tmpdir, **save_kwargs)
|
|
|
|
# Update model card if needed:
|
|
model_card.save(os.path.join(tmpdir, "README.md"))
|
|
|
|
return self._upload_folder(
|
|
tmpdir,
|
|
repo_id,
|
|
token=token,
|
|
commit_message=commit_message,
|
|
create_pr=create_pr,
|
|
)
